(1) Each warrant of the Finance and Administration Cabinet upon the Treasury shall specify the date, amount, and person to whom payable, and no money shall be disbursed by the Treasurer unless the warrant contains these specifications. (2) No warrant shall be issued unless the money to pay it has been appropriated by law. The Finance and Administration Cabinet may require any claimant to state on the face of his claim the law under which it is payable. (3) The Finance and Administration Cabinet shall record all warrants in the unified and integrated system of accounts. (4) The Treasurer shall maintain electronic records in the unified and integrated syst em of accounts that show all checks issued, the name of the payee, date, and amount and shall be in a format that is readily reconcilable with the warrants issued by the Finance and Administration Cabinet.
